ABSTRACT

This chapter identifies six ingredients that may be used to build any story and identifies how each moves readers or listeners through the Story Funnel. The ingredients are a person, a challenge, a setting, details, a sequence of events, and a resolution. Each ingredient is illustrated in practice via examples of online storytelling. The chapter ends with a discussion of the role of artificial intelligence (AI) writing programs, before concluding that writers should be valued for their empathy, knowledge of the world, and awareness of how to connect with readers and listeners.
